Adjective

hypodermic (not comparable)

  1. Of, or relating to the hypodermis, the layer beneath the dermis

Noun

English Wikipedia has an article on:
Wikipedia

hypodermic (plural hypodermics)

  1. A hypodermic syringe, needle or injection
